背景技术Background technique
随着建筑业的迅速发展,国家对结构墙板预制率的要求越来越高,为满足国家对建筑物预制率的要求,目前,设计院普遍采用ALC预制墙板代替传统的砌体填充墙。在施工现场,尤其在室内施工的情况下,ALC墙板是依靠工人之间相互配合安装到位的,为方便室内的ALC墙板安装的起吊,减轻工人的劳动量,因此出现了ALC墙板吊装设备来辅助ALC墙板的吊装。With the rapid development of the construction industry, the country's requirements for the prefabrication rate of structural wall panels are getting higher and higher. In order to meet the country's requirements for the prefabrication rate of buildings, currently, design institutes generally use ALC prefabricated wall panels to replace traditional masonry infill walls. . At the construction site, especially in indoor construction, ALC wall panels are installed in place relying on the cooperation of workers. In order to facilitate the lifting of indoor ALC wall panel installation and reduce the workload of workers, ALC wall panel hoisting has emerged. Equipment to assist in the lifting of ALC wall panels.
申请号为202120742685.2公开了一种简易ALC墙板吊装设备,其通过配重、自锁万向轮和水平顶撑来增加装置起吊的稳定性,其不能进行高度调节,不能将装置顶部顶在屋顶上,在起吊ALC墙板时,受力可知造成装置的偏移,针对上述问题,提出了一种ALC墙板吊装设备。The application number is 202120742685.2, which discloses a simple ALC wall panel hoisting equipment. It uses counterweights, self-locking universal wheels and horizontal jacking supports to increase the stability of the hoisting of the device. It cannot be height adjusted and the top of the device cannot be placed on the roof. When lifting ALC wall panels, it can be seen that the force causes the device to shift. To address the above problems, an ALC wall panel hoisting equipment is proposed.

所述调节架3包括两根竖管13和手动液压缸14,竖管13对称的固定连接在底架1中,竖管13内滑动连接有支撑柱17,支撑柱17底端固定连接有横管19,横管19之间共同的固定连接有连接管18,手动液压缸14底端固定连接在连接管18底部固定连接,手动液压缸14的活动端与相邻的竖管13侧壁相连接,与立柱4相邻的横管19与立柱4侧壁固定连接。The adjustment frame 3 includes two vertical pipes 13 and a manual hydraulic cylinder 14. The vertical pipes 13 are symmetrically and fixedly connected to the chassis 1. A support column 17 is slidingly connected in the vertical pipe 13. The bottom end of the support column 17 is fixedly connected with a horizontal crossbar. The pipe 19 and the horizontal pipe 19 are jointly fixedly connected with a connecting pipe 18. The bottom end of the manual hydraulic cylinder 14 is fixedly connected to the bottom of the connecting pipe 18. The movable end of the manual hydraulic cylinder 14 is connected to the side wall of the adjacent vertical pipe 13. Connection, the transverse tube 19 adjacent to the upright column 4 is fixedly connected to the side wall of the upright column 4.
通过手动液压缸14推着调节架3移动,使得横管19和连接管18与地面贴合,手动液压缸14活动端继续伸长,使得立柱4顶端的顶撑8与房屋顶部贴合,实现对装置的固定,增加对ALC墙板起吊的稳定性,收卷机构5工作,将钢丝绳11放长,钢丝绳11绕设在ALC墙板上,并通过挂钩12锁上,收卷机构5收卷钢丝绳11对ALC墙板进行起吊。The manual hydraulic cylinder 14 pushes the adjustment frame 3 to move, so that the horizontal pipe 19 and the connecting pipe 18 fit with the ground. The movable end of the manual hydraulic cylinder 14 continues to extend, so that the top support 8 of the column 4 fits with the top of the house. To fix the device and increase the stability of lifting the ALC wall panel, the rewinding mechanism 5 works to lengthen the wire rope 11. The wire rope 11 is wound around the ALC wall panel and locked through the hook 12. The rewinding mechanism 5 rewinds the device. The wire rope 11 lifts the ALC wall panel.
所述竖管13侧壁对称的固定连接有拉撑15,拉撑15增加竖管13之间的稳定性。The side walls of the vertical pipes 13 are symmetrically and fixedly connected with tension braces 15 , and the tension braces 15 increase the stability between the vertical pipes 13 .
其中远离立柱4的所述竖管13外壁固定连接有推杆16,推杆16两端套设的固定连接有橡胶套。A push rod 16 is fixedly connected to the outer wall of the vertical pipe 13 away from the upright column 4, and rubber sleeves are fixedly connected to both ends of the push rod 16.
所述收卷机构5包括两个安装座20,安装座20固定安装在底架1顶部,安装座20之间转动连接有收卷辊21,钢丝绳11绕设在收卷辊21上,且钢丝绳11端部与收卷辊21相连接,其中一个安装座20侧壁固定连接有电机22,电机22输出端贯穿安装座20与收卷辊21端部固定连接,电机22驱动收卷辊21转动,实现对钢丝绳11进行收卷,实现对ALC墙板进行起吊。The rewinding mechanism 5 includes two mounting seats 20. The mounting seats 20 are fixedly installed on the top of the chassis 1. A rewinding roller 21 is rotatably connected between the mounting seats 20. The steel wire rope 11 is wound around the rewinding roller 21, and the steel wire rope is The end of 11 is connected to the winding roller 21, and a motor 22 is fixedly connected to the side wall of one of the mounting bases 20. The output end of the motor 22 penetrates the mounting base 20 and is fixedly connected to the end of the winding roller 21. The motor 22 drives the winding roller 21 to rotate. , to realize the winding of the steel wire rope 11 and to realize the lifting of the ALC wall panel.
所述底架1顶部固定安装有第一定滑轮6,钢丝绳11穿过第一定滑轮6,第一定滑轮6增加钢丝绳11收卷时的稳定性。A first fixed pulley 6 is fixedly installed on the top of the chassis 1. The steel wire rope 11 passes through the first fixed pulley 6. The first fixed pulley 6 increases the stability of the steel wire rope 11 when it is rolled up.
所述支撑机构9包括螺杆23,螺杆23贯穿立柱4,且螺杆23与立柱4螺纹连接,螺杆23一端固定连接有手柄24,螺杆23另一端转动连接有顶板25,通过手柄24转动螺杆23,螺杆23推着顶板25与相对的房梁紧贴,增加装置吊装ALC墙板的稳定性。The support mechanism 9 includes a screw rod 23 that penetrates the column 4 and is threadedly connected to the column 4. One end of the screw rod 23 is fixedly connected to a handle 24, and the other end of the screw rod 23 is rotatably connected to a top plate 25. The screw rod 23 is rotated through the handle 24. The screw rod 23 pushes the top plate 25 to be in close contact with the opposite beam, thereby increasing the stability of the device for hoisting the ALC wall panels.
所述底架1底部四角通过螺栓固定连接有万向轮2,万向轮2方便装置的移动,从而方便调整装置的工作位置。The four corners of the bottom of the chassis 1 are fixedly connected with universal wheels 2 through bolts. The universal wheels 2 facilitate the movement of the device and thereby facilitate the adjustment of the working position of the device.
